Buescher Aims to Close Points Gap at Smith’s 350

September 24, 2013

NASCAR Truck Series – Smith’s 350
September 28, 2013 – Las Vegas Motor Speedway
James Buescher, No. 31

James Buescher and his Exide EDGE team head into Vegas coming off an eighth-place finish at Chicagoland Speedway two weeks ago. This was the team’s fifth top-10 finish in a row. Buescher has four previous starts at Las Vegas Motor Speedway (LVMS) and has an average finish of 10.8. Buescher’s best result at LVMS came in 2010 when he finished in the third position. Buescher and his Exide EDGE team will also have a chassis that is a proven winner at LVMS in their quest to close the points gap to the leader.

Las Vegas is always one of the tracks that I look forward to coming to each and every year. I’m really happy with my Exide team’s performance and I feel like they will have a great truck prepared for us. We’re still fighting for wins and I feel like we have a great opportunity to get our third of the season this weekend in Vegas. – James Buescher

NASCAR Truck Series results at Las Vegas Motor Speedway

  • Starts: 4
  • Wins: 0
  • Poles: 0
  • Top 5: 1
  • Top 10: 2
  • Laps Led: 17
  • Average Start: 9.5
  • Average Finish: 10.8
